Title :
Design of partitioned table for VLDB in the vehicle monitoring system

Abstract :
As the number of vehicles in the monitoring system increases, the size of the table for storing their past data becomes very large, which brings performance troubles occurred in the systems with VLDB. To improve the data-access efficiency and keep the database stability, the original table is proposed to be partitioned. According to the functional requirements for database from the vehicle monitoring system, the range partition is suggested, with twelve partitions for one year´s historical data and each partition corresponding to a separate month. Then the partitioned table is created after finishing the definitions of the partitioning function and the partitioning schema, where the former gives a rule for partitioning and the latter specifies the storage places of partitions to different file groups. Because the data in the partitioned table is separated into several file groups, the data-access is capable of parallel processing and keeps a higher efficiency. Tests show that the partitioned table works in improving the database performance and the query time is greatly reduced compared to that cost in the original table.
